欢迎光临连南能五网络有限公司司官网!
全国咨询热线:13768600254
当前位置: 首页 > 新闻动态

Python字符串中数字与文字数字的鲁棒提取教程

时间:2025-11-28 20:12:21

Python字符串中数字与文字数字的鲁棒提取教程
<?php // 1. 设置目标时区 $dateTimeZone = new DateTimeZone('Europe/Amsterdam'); $date = new DateTime('now', $dateTimeZone); // 获取当前时间,并应用目标时区 // 2. 初始化用于计算发货日期的DateTime对象 // 克隆$date以避免修改原始的当前时间对象 $deliveryDate = clone $date; // 3. 根据条件判断并修改$deliveryDate $currentDay = $deliveryDate->format('D'); // 获取当前星期几(例如 'Wed') $currentHour = (int)$deliveryDate->format('G'); // 获取当前小时(24小时制,例如 17) if ($currentDay === 'Wed' && $currentHour >= 17) { // 如果是周三,且时间在下午5点或之后 // 显示下下周四(即下周的周四) $deliveryDate->modify('thursday next week'); } elseif ($currentDay === 'Tue' || $currentDay === 'Wed') { // 如果是周二,或者周三但在下午5点之前 // 显示下一个周四 $deliveryDate->modify('next thursday'); } else { // 其他任何一天(周一、周四、周五、周六、周日) // 显示下一个周四 $deliveryDate->modify('next thursday'); } // 4. 格式化并输出结果 $delivery_date_formatted = $deliveryDate->format('d-m-Y'); echo "发货日期: " . $delivery_date_formatted; ?>4. 代码解析与最佳实践 DateTimeZone: 确保日期时间处理在正确的时区下进行,避免因服务器时区不同而导致的问题。
立即学习“PHP免费学习笔记(深入)”; 在 PHP 中嵌入 JavaScript 警告框 虽然上述代码可以验证 Email 并输出文本信息,但有时需要在客户端使用 JavaScript 警告框来显示验证结果。
负载均衡器(如Nginx、Envoy)根据健康状态路由流量。
本文探讨了在Go语言中如何通过进程名称而非PID来判断一个进程是否正在运行。
例如,“诊所拥有病人”,那么 Clinic 类会包含一个或多个 Patient 对象的集合。
在使用PHP命令行脚本时,传递变量参数是常见需求。
然而,默认的样式和行为可能无法完全满足所有项目的特定设计或功能需求。
以下是使用 io.ReadFull 从 bufio.Reader 读取指定数量字节的示例代码:package main import ( "bufio" "fmt" "io" "strings" ) func main() { // 创建一个字符串读取器 reader := strings.NewReader("Hello, world!") // 创建一个带缓冲的读取器 bufReader := bufio.NewReader(reader) // 要读取的字节数 numBytes := 5 // 创建一个字节切片来存储读取的数据 p := make([]byte, numBytes) // 使用 io.ReadFull 读取指定数量的字节 n, err := io.ReadFull(bufReader, p) // 处理错误 if err != nil { fmt.Println("Error reading:", err) return } // 打印读取的字节数和数据 fmt.Println("Read", n, "bytes:", string(p)) // 验证读取器是否已前进 remaining, _ := bufReader.Peek(5) fmt.Println("Remaining:", string(remaining)) }代码解释: 立即学习“go语言免费学习笔记(深入)”; 小绿鲸英文文献阅读器 英文文献阅读器,专注提高SCI阅读效率 40 查看详情 创建读取器: 首先,我们使用 strings.NewReader 创建一个字符串读取器,并将其包装在 bufio.NewReader 中,创建一个带缓冲的读取器。
特点: 延迟加载,但需处理多线程安全问题。
主函数中替换Template的algo字段为不同实现,调用Execute产生不同输出。
并且,这些参数在传递给处理函数时,是否需要进行类型转换(例如,确保id是整数)?
注意事项: 至少读取一个字节: Go 1.7 及以上版本中,零字节读取会立即返回,不会返回错误。
在使用 Laravel Eloquent 构建复杂查询时,经常需要将父模型的 ID 传递到其关联模型的子查询中,以便更精确地过滤数据。
在生产环境中,应监控查询性能并进行必要的优化,例如添加索引。
核心方法是利用html的数组输入(`name="fieldname[]"`)来收集多个值,并通过隐藏字段(`hidden` inputs)在每次提交时保留并传递历史数据,最终在php中迭代并显示所有累积的提交内容。
如果不存在,则返回 404 错误。
Returns: dict: 键为工作表名称,值为合并后的DataFrame的字典。
如果不匹配,客户端可能会遇到解析错误、数据截断或连接挂起等问题。
这是处理通道关闭最简洁、最常用的方式之一。
def build_advanced_filters_from_dict(model: Base, filter_dict: dict) -> List[Any]: """ 从字典构建SQLAlchemy过滤表达式列表,支持简单的相等、LIKE、大于、小于操作。

本文链接:http://www.veneramodels.com/197315_365a31.html